Key ingredients with descriptions of S N Pandit Ashwagandadi Churna
- Ashwagandha (Withania somnifera): revered adaptogen traditionally used to nourish tissues and strengthen vitality
- Nagara (Zingiber officinale): ginger rhizome known for warming and digestive support
- Kana (Piper longum): long pepper fruit used in classical formulas to kindle digestive fire
- Maricha (Piper nigrum): black pepper, aids bioavailability and digestion
- Twak (Cinnamomum zeylanicum): cinnamon bark, supports healthy metabolism and circulation
- Ela (Elettaria cardamomum): cardamom seeds, soothing to the digestive tract
- Patra (Cinnamomum tamala): bay leaf, gentle aromatic stimulant
- Nagakeshara (Mesua ferrea): flower resin, traditional astringent quality
- Varala (Syzygium aromaticum): clove, classic warming spice
- Bharngi (Clerodendron serratum): root used to support respiratory and digestive wellness
- Taleesa Patra (Abies webbiana): fir tree leaves, aromatic component
- Karchura (Curcuma zeodaria): a type of turmeric, known for digestive stimulation
- Ajaji (Nigella sativa): small black seed, traditionally used for multiple health support
- Kaidarya (Murraya koenigii): curry leaf, aromatic digestive aid
- Mamsi (Nardostachys jatamansi): spikenard root, calming herb
- Kankola (Piper cubeba): tailed pepper, digestive stimulant
- Musta (Cyperus rotundus): nut grass root, supports gastrointestinal comfort
- Rasna (Pluchea lanceolata): herb used as a general tonic
- Katukarohini (Picrorhiza kurroa): herb valued for liver and digestive wellness
- Jivanti (Leptadenia reticulata): rejuvenative vine, traditional Rasayana
- Kushta (Saussurea lappa): costus root, aromatic tonic
- Sharkara (Sugar): sweetening agent to balance the blend

How to use S N Pandit Ashwagandadi Churna
Take 3 grams (approx. ½ teaspoon) once or twice daily, before or after meals, mixed in warm water, milk, ghee or honey as per your dosha needs or as directed by your Ayurvedic practitioner.
